Skip to content

Commit 073fbaf

Browse files
authored
Update external-libraries.md (#11242)
1 parent dbd9257 commit 073fbaf

File tree

1 file changed

+27
-23
lines changed

1 file changed

+27
-23
lines changed

external-libraries.md

Lines changed: 27 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-691,9 +691,13 @@ License: BSD-3-Clause
691691
692692
## Sorted list of runtime dependencies output by gradle
693693
694-
1. `./gradlew dependencies > build/dependencies.txt`
695-
2. Manually edit depedencies.txt to contain the tree of "compileClasspath" and "implementation" only. Otherwise, libraries such as "Apache Commons Lang 3" are missed. Ensure LF as line ending.
696-
3. (on WSL) `sed 's/[^a-z]*//' < build/dependencies.txt | sed "s/\(.*\) .*/\1/" | grep -v "\->" | sort | uniq > build/dependencies-for-external-libraries.txt`
694+
1. `./gradlew dependencyReport --configuration compileClasspath`
695+
2. Fix `build/reports/project/dependencies.txt`
696+
697+
- Change line endings to `LF`
698+
- Remove text above and below the tree
699+
700+
3. (on WSL) `sed 's/[^a-z]*//' < build/reports/project/dependencies.txt | sed "s/\(.*\) .*/\1/" | grep -v "\->" | sort | uniq > build/dependencies-for-external-libraries.txt`
697701

698702
```text
699703
at.favre.lib:hkdf:1.1.0
@@ -809,7 +813,7 @@ org.apache.pdfbox:fontbox:3.0.2
809813
org.apache.pdfbox:pdfbox-io:3.0.2
810814
org.apache.pdfbox:pdfbox:3.0.2
811815
org.apache.pdfbox:xmpbox:3.0.2
812-
org.bouncycastle:bcprov-jdk18on:1.77
816+
org.bouncycastle:bcprov-jdk18on:1.78
813817
org.checkerframework:checker-qual:3.42.0
814818
org.codehaus.woodstox:stax2-api:4.2
815819
org.controlsfx:controlsfx:11.2.1
@@ -818,24 +822,24 @@ org.fxmisc.flowless:flowless:0.7.2
818822
org.fxmisc.richtext:richtextfx:0.11.2
819823
org.fxmisc.undo:undofx:2.1.1
820824
org.fxmisc.wellbehaved:wellbehavedfx:0.3.3
821-
org.glassfish.grizzly:grizzly-framework:4.0.1
822-
org.glassfish.grizzly:grizzly-http-server:4.0.1
823-
org.glassfish.grizzly:grizzly-http:4.0.1
825+
org.glassfish.grizzly:grizzly-framework:4.0.2
826+
org.glassfish.grizzly:grizzly-http-server:4.0.2
827+
org.glassfish.grizzly:grizzly-http:4.0.2
824828
org.glassfish.hk2.external:aopalliance-repackaged:3.1.0
825829
org.glassfish.hk2:hk2-api:3.1.0
826-
org.glassfish.hk2:hk2-locator:3.0.5
830+
org.glassfish.hk2:hk2-locator:3.0.6
827831
org.glassfish.hk2:hk2-utils:3.1.0
828832
org.glassfish.hk2:osgi-resource-locator:1.0.3
829833
org.glassfish.jaxb:jaxb-core:4.0.3
830834
org.glassfish.jaxb:jaxb-runtime:4.0.3
831835
org.glassfish.jaxb:txw2:4.0.3
832-
org.glassfish.jersey.containers:jersey-container-grizzly2-http:3.1.5
833-
org.glassfish.jersey.core:jersey-client:3.1.5
834-
org.glassfish.jersey.core:jersey-common:3.1.5
835-
org.glassfish.jersey.core:jersey-server:3.1.5
836-
org.glassfish.jersey.inject:jersey-hk2:3.1.5
836+
org.glassfish.jersey.containers:jersey-container-grizzly2-http:3.1.6
837+
org.glassfish.jersey.core:jersey-client:3.1.6
838+
org.glassfish.jersey.core:jersey-common:3.1.6
839+
org.glassfish.jersey.core:jersey-server:3.1.6
840+
org.glassfish.jersey.inject:jersey-hk2:3.1.6
837841
org.jabref:afterburner.fx:2.0.0
838-
org.javassist:javassist:3.29.2-GA
842+
org.javassist:javassist:3.30.2-GA
839843
org.jbibtex:jbibtex:1.0.20
840844
org.jetbrains:annotations:24.0.1
841845
org.jooq:jool:0.9.15
@@ -850,18 +854,18 @@ org.kordamp.ikonli:ikonli-materialdesign2-pack:12.3.1
850854
org.libreoffice:libreoffice:7.6.4
851855
org.libreoffice:unoloader:7.6.4
852856
org.mariadb.jdbc:mariadb-java-client:2.7.9
853-
org.openjfx:javafx-base:22
854-
org.openjfx:javafx-controls:22
855-
org.openjfx:javafx-fxml:22
856-
org.openjfx:javafx-graphics:22
857-
org.openjfx:javafx-media:22
858-
org.openjfx:javafx-swing:22
859-
org.openjfx:javafx-web:22
857+
org.openjfx:javafx-base:22.0.1
858+
org.openjfx:javafx-controls:22.0.1
859+
org.openjfx:javafx-fxml:22.0.1
860+
org.openjfx:javafx-graphics:22.0.1
861+
org.openjfx:javafx-media:22.0.1
862+
org.openjfx:javafx-swing:22.0.1
863+
org.openjfx:javafx-web:22.0.1
860864
org.postgresql:postgresql:42.7.3
861865
org.reactfx:reactfx:2.0-M5
862866
org.scala-lang:scala-library:2.13.8
863-
org.slf4j:jul-to-slf4j:2.0.12
864-
org.slf4j:slf4j-api:2.0.12
867+
org.slf4j:jul-to-slf4j:2.0.13
868+
org.slf4j:slf4j-api:2.0.13
865869
org.tinylog:slf4j-tinylog:2.7.0
866870
org.tinylog:tinylog-api:2.7.0
867871
org.tinylog:tinylog-impl:2.7.0

0 commit comments

Comments
 (0)